Understanding common legal terms can help clarify the claims process. From liability and damages to settlements and statutes of limitations, being familiar with these concepts supports informed decision-making throughout your case.
Liability refers to legal responsibility for the accident. Determining who is liable is essential for establishing who must compensate the injured party for damages.
Damages are the monetary compensation sought for losses suffered due to the accident, including med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and property damage.
A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ve the claim without going to trial, often involving compensation paid by the liable party or their insurer.
The statute of limitations is the legal deadline by which a claim must be filed. Missing this deadline can result in losing the right to pursue compensation.

In California,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including motorcycle accidents, is typically two years from the date of the accident. It is important to initiate your claim within this timeframe to preserve your right to seek compensation. Certain exceptions may apply, so consulting with a legal team promptly is advisable.

Fault in motorcycle accidents is determined based on evidence such as police reports, witness statements, and traffic laws. Liability can be shared among parties. A thorough investigation is essential to establish fault accurately and support your claim for compensation.
California follows a comparative fault system, meaning you can recover damages even if you are partially at fault, though your compensation may be reduced by your percentage of fault. Legal assistance can help assess your case and negotiate accordingly.
If the other driver lacks insurance, you may still recover damages through your own uninsured motorist coverage or other legal avenues. An attorney can help explore all options to secure compensation despite uninsured motorists.
Many motorcycle accident att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ay legal fees only if you receive compensation. This arrangement makes legal representation accessible without upfront costs. Discuss fee structures during your initial consultation.
Important evidence includes accident reports, medical records, photographs of the scene and injuries, witness statements, and any communication with insurance companies. Collecting and preserving this evidence is crucial for building a strong case.
